Public Safety Concerns Grow As Doctors Silenced Over Health System Failings

Saturday, 5 July 2025, 5:10 pm
Press Release: North and South magazine

3 July 2025

Doctors across New
Zealand say they are being silenced from speaking out about
potentially dangerous conditions in the public health
system—fearing employment consequences, professional
isolation, and even job loss. Some have chosen early
retirement rather than continue working under what they
describe as a “climate of fear,” raising serious
concerns about public safety.

Dr Renee
Liang, a respected medical specialist and writer, surveyed
colleagues across the health sector for an article published
by North & South. She received dozens of
anonymous responses, revealing a consistent and alarming
theme: doctors do not feel safe to speak publicly—even
when patient wellbeing is at
risk.

“Feeling safe is a rare feeling
among most of my colleagues right now,” says Dr Liang.
“There’s a real fear that just speaking out will draw a
target on your back.”

Under current contractual
obligations, senior doctors are required to report safety
issues—but many say that doing so can result in formal
complaints, retaliation, or even termination.

One
anonymous doctor described the pressure
vividly:

“I’ve never seen anything like the
current environment. The public should be demanding
transparency—monthly updates from every hospital
department about staff losses, waiting times,
under-resourcing. It’s so much worse than people
imagine.”

Dr Liang asked her colleagues two simple
questions:

  1. Would you feel comfortable speaking to
    the media about important health issues in your area of
    expertise? If not, why not?
  2. Do you believe
    clinicians are being explicitly or implicitly discouraged
    from making public comment?

The responses came
in within hours—from junior doctors to senior clinicians
and health leaders. The overwhelming consensus: it
is unsafe to speak out
—whether in public
hospitals or even in primary care.

“HR processes are
being weaponised to silence otherwise powerful
professionals,” says Dr Liang. “This isn’t just about
protecting reputations—it’s costing
lives.”

Further inflaming the issue, Deputy Prime
Minister David Seymour recently referred to health
professionals as “muppets,” a comment that many in the
sector found demeaning and dangerous. Seymour also mocked Dr
George Laking, a prominent medical oncologist, via a social
media meme after Laking expressed concern over proposed
legislative changes to health regulation.

“When
politicians attack experts, it sends a chilling message
across the system,” says Dr Liang. “Instead of
addressing the issues, they’re using public platforms to
intimidate and deflect.”

Doctors also report deep
concern over job insecurity—particularly for those on
temporary contracts, locum placements, or in training roles.
One respondent said:

“Even contacting my MP feels
risky. You wonder how deep the influence goes. With no job
security, speaking out could blacklist you from future
roles.”

The impact on the health system is already
being felt, says Dr Liang:

“At least three
colleagues I know personally have taken early retirement
because they couldn’t raise safety concerns without fear
of reprisal. Others are leaving quietly, wracked with
guilt.”

Haematologist Dr Ruth Spearing CNZM
added:

“Speaking out is so important. I’d
be lying if I said I didn’t feel fear—but it was worth
it.”

Dr Liang concludes:

“The public
deserves transparency. Instead, clinicians are being
silenced by a system more focused on managing optics than
fixing structural issues. And when that happens—patients
suffer.

“Clinical decision making requires good
communication; we need to be able to talk openly about
systems issues if we’re to reduce clinical errors. How can
we advocate for the things our health system needs to be
urgently better at if we can’t even call out what is
happening? How can we continue to practice ethically and
fairly?”
